auto merge of #5354 : ILyoan/rust/normalize_triple, r=graydon
LLVM could not recognize target-os when target-triple was given as like 'arm-linux-androideabi'. Normalizing target-triple fill the missing elements. In the case of 'arm-linux-androideabi', nomalized target-triple will be "arm-unknown-linux-androideabi" and this let llvm recognize the triple correctly. (arch: arm, vendor: unknown, os: linux, environment: android)
